北京阿里云代理商:API機(jī)制
一、什么是API機(jī)制?
API(Application Programming Interface,應(yīng)用程序接口)機(jī)制是指不同的軟件組件、系統(tǒng)、服務(wù)之間進(jìn)行數(shù)據(jù)交換和功能調(diào)用的一種方式。在云計(jì)算環(huán)境下,API機(jī)制是一種允許用戶(hù)、開(kāi)發(fā)者和系統(tǒng)之間高效、靈活地進(jìn)行交互的重要手段。阿里云作為國(guó)內(nèi)領(lǐng)先的云計(jì)算服務(wù)提供商,其API機(jī)制不僅提高了操作效率,還為用戶(hù)提供了強(qiáng)大的管理能力。
二、阿里云API機(jī)制的優(yōu)勢(shì)
1. 高效的資源管理
阿里云的API機(jī)制使得用戶(hù)可以通過(guò)編程的方式對(duì)其云服務(wù)資源進(jìn)行精細(xì)化管理。無(wú)論是計(jì)算、存儲(chǔ)、網(wǎng)絡(luò)還是數(shù)據(jù)庫(kù)資源,都可以通過(guò)API接口輕松實(shí)現(xiàn)創(chuàng)建、配置、監(jiān)控、銷(xiāo)毀等操作。這種機(jī)制使得用戶(hù)能夠迅速適應(yīng)云環(huán)境,并大大降低了人工干預(yù)的風(fēng)險(xiǎn)。
2. 靈活的擴(kuò)展性
通過(guò)阿里云的API,用戶(hù)可以根據(jù)業(yè)務(wù)需求靈活擴(kuò)展或縮減資源。API機(jī)制支持自動(dòng)化資源配置和動(dòng)態(tài)擴(kuò)展,適應(yīng)不斷變化的業(yè)務(wù)需求,無(wú)需人工干預(yù),從而提高了業(yè)務(wù)的靈活性和響應(yīng)速度。
3. 提高開(kāi)發(fā)效率
開(kāi)發(fā)者可以通過(guò)調(diào)用阿里云提供的API接口,快速實(shí)現(xiàn)對(duì)云資源的訪問(wèn)和管理。比如,通過(guò)API接口,開(kāi)發(fā)者可以創(chuàng)建云服務(wù)器ECS、配置負(fù)載均衡、使用對(duì)象存儲(chǔ)OSS等云服務(wù)。所有這些操作都可以通過(guò)腳本或程序自動(dòng)化完成,從而顯著提高開(kāi)發(fā)效率。
4. 強(qiáng)大的安全性保障
阿里云的API接口為用戶(hù)提供了多層次的安全保護(hù)。通過(guò)API訪問(wèn)控制,用戶(hù)可以確保只有授權(quán)的用戶(hù)和服務(wù)可以訪問(wèn)云資源。此外,阿里云還提供了完善的身份驗(yàn)證和數(shù)據(jù)加密機(jī)制,保障數(shù)據(jù)的安全性和隱私性。
5. 豐富的功能支持
阿里云的API覆蓋了云計(jì)算的方方面面,從計(jì)算、存儲(chǔ)、網(wǎng)絡(luò)到安全、人工智能等多個(gè)領(lǐng)域,幾乎涵蓋了所有云服務(wù)功能。用戶(hù)可以根據(jù)具體需求靈活選擇合適的API接口,進(jìn)行定制化開(kāi)發(fā)和功能擴(kuò)展。
三、阿里云API機(jī)制如何幫助企業(yè)降低IT成本
1. 自動(dòng)化管理,降低人力成本
阿里云API機(jī)制可以實(shí)現(xiàn)云資源的自動(dòng)化管理,用戶(hù)不再需要依賴(lài)大量的人力去進(jìn)行日常的系統(tǒng)維護(hù)和資源配置。開(kāi)發(fā)者可以通過(guò)腳本批量創(chuàng)建、更新、刪除云資源,極大提高了工作效率,減少了企業(yè)在IT方面的人力成本。
2. 按需付費(fèi),優(yōu)化成本結(jié)構(gòu)
阿里云采用按需付費(fèi)的計(jì)費(fèi)模式,結(jié)合API機(jī)制,企業(yè)可以實(shí)時(shí)監(jiān)控并調(diào)整所使用的資源。當(dāng)業(yè)務(wù)量增大時(shí),可以通過(guò)API動(dòng)態(tài)調(diào)整資源,避免資源浪費(fèi);當(dāng)業(yè)務(wù)量下降時(shí),可以及時(shí)縮減資源,避免不必要的開(kāi)支。通過(guò)API,企業(yè)能夠根據(jù)實(shí)際需求精確控制云資源,從而最大限度地優(yōu)化成本結(jié)構(gòu)。
3. 靈活部署,避免過(guò)度投資
傳統(tǒng)IT基礎(chǔ)設(shè)施部署往往需要一次性投入大量的資金和人力,并且存在資源閑置和浪費(fèi)的風(fēng)險(xiǎn)。而通過(guò)阿里云的API機(jī)制,企業(yè)可以實(shí)現(xiàn)彈性擴(kuò)展和動(dòng)態(tài)調(diào)整,避免過(guò)度投資或資源浪費(fèi)。無(wú)論是短期項(xiàng)目還是長(zhǎng)期運(yùn)營(yíng),都可以根據(jù)實(shí)際需求靈活部署和調(diào)整資源,避免了不必要的資金占用。

四、阿里云API機(jī)制的應(yīng)用場(chǎng)景
1. 大規(guī)?;ヂ?lián)網(wǎng)應(yīng)用
對(duì)于大型互聯(lián)網(wǎng)應(yīng)用,阿里云提供的API機(jī)制能夠幫助企業(yè)快速部署、擴(kuò)展并管理云基礎(chǔ)設(shè)施。通過(guò)API接口,企業(yè)可以實(shí)現(xiàn)自動(dòng)化部署、負(fù)載均衡、資源彈性伸縮等功能,確保在高并發(fā)情況下系統(tǒng)能夠平穩(wěn)運(yùn)行。
2. 數(shù)據(jù)分析與機(jī)器學(xué)習(xí)
阿里云提供了豐富的數(shù)據(jù)分析、人工智能和機(jī)器學(xué)習(xí)API接口,幫助企業(yè)快速搭建數(shù)據(jù)分析平臺(tái)和AI模型。企業(yè)可以通過(guò)API將數(shù)據(jù)從不同的源頭導(dǎo)入阿里云,并利用云端計(jì)算能力進(jìn)行數(shù)據(jù)處理和機(jī)器學(xué)習(xí)模型訓(xùn)練。
3. 企業(yè)數(shù)字化轉(zhuǎn)型
對(duì)于正在進(jìn)行數(shù)字化轉(zhuǎn)型的企業(yè)來(lái)說(shuō),阿里云的API機(jī)制可以幫助企業(yè)實(shí)現(xiàn)從傳統(tǒng)IT架構(gòu)到云計(jì)算架構(gòu)的平滑過(guò)渡。通過(guò)API接口,企業(yè)能夠?qū)F(xiàn)有的系統(tǒng)與阿里云服務(wù)對(duì)接,逐步遷移到云端,提升業(yè)務(wù)的靈活性和響應(yīng)速度。
五、如何使用阿里云API?
1. 獲取API訪問(wèn)憑證
首先,用戶(hù)需要在阿里云控制臺(tái)中創(chuàng)建一個(gè)API密鑰(AccessKey)。該密鑰包含一個(gè)AccessKey ID和一個(gè)AccessKey Secret,是進(jìn)行API調(diào)用的認(rèn)證憑證。
2. 調(diào)用API接口
在獲得API訪問(wèn)憑證后,用戶(hù)可以選擇不同的編程語(yǔ)言(如Python、Java、Go等)通過(guò)HTTP請(qǐng)求調(diào)用阿里云的API接口。阿里云提供了豐富的SDK和文檔支持,幫助開(kāi)發(fā)者更快上手。
3. 管理API權(quán)限
為了保障API的安全性,用戶(hù)需要配置API訪問(wèn)控制(RAM角色)和權(quán)限策略,確保只有授權(quán)的人員和服務(wù)能夠訪問(wèn)特定的API接口。
總結(jié)
阿里云的API機(jī)制為用戶(hù)提供了靈活、高效、安全的云資源管理方式,尤其對(duì)于企業(yè)來(lái)說(shuō),通過(guò)API可以實(shí)現(xiàn)自動(dòng)化運(yùn)維、按需付費(fèi)和資源優(yōu)化,極大地提升了企業(yè)的運(yùn)營(yíng)效率和成本效益。阿里云提供的豐富功能接口、強(qiáng)大的擴(kuò)展性以及完善的安全機(jī)制,使其成為現(xiàn)代企業(yè)數(shù)字化轉(zhuǎn)型的重要工具。隨著云計(jì)算技術(shù)的不斷發(fā)展,阿里云的API機(jī)制將在未來(lái)繼續(xù)發(fā)揮重要作用,幫助更多企業(yè)實(shí)現(xiàn)業(yè)務(wù)增長(zhǎng)與創(chuàng)新。
